Did Healing Spirit end up being overpowered?

The actual problem - since he seems incapable of pointing it out - is that it can basically instantly heal any party to full health out of combat with almost no investment at all. Out of combat healing isn't the problem, it's the amount; it's almost 4 times as effective as Prayer of Healing, making Life Clerics basically redundant out of combat now (Not that anyone was using PoH anyway, which is a problem in and of itself).

They've given the best out of combat healing in the game to the ranger and not the most traditional healing class in D&D. There are also DMs who don't want their players to just top back up to full health in less than 5 minutes after every fight, but that' a per-table scenario.
